Volunteering at tech meetups, contributing to non-profits, engaging in mentorship programs, and joining open source projects can help women in tech expand their networks and skills. Leading workshops, participating in hackathons, supporting local STEM initiatives, writing technical content, joining volunteer organizations, and serving on tech committees are also valuable for professional growth and leadership development. These activities offer opportunities to connect with industry leaders, exchange ideas, and become recognized experts.
